Transaction 2795751a398e10bf4c07b8db148f0460b6b38839641e85b8c9d8c3879b035e06
1 Input
1 Outputs
- 2795751a398e10bf4c07b8db148f0460b6b38839641e85b8c9d8c3879b035e06:0
value 3244916
address 34c3oEsemNGN5nfatDTypmyEeUE6XGnWcp